St. John: On Aug. 25 about 7:35 a.m., a citizen reported at the Leander Jurgen Command that someone stole the four wheels of her daughter’s vehicle, a red Ford Focus, while it was parked in the Enighed Pond parking lot.

St. Thomas: On Sept. 4 at 4 a.m. in the area of Oswald Harris Court, 26-year-old Keithroy Caines was killed by a shot to the head. The police are seeking information on this homicide. If you saw or heard anything, say something, no matter how insignificant as it might seem. It might be just what police need to solve the crime.

St. Croix: During the past several days St. Croix has experienced a number of robberies and carjackings. One attempted carjacking occurred as recently as Wednesday evening, a robbery on Thursday and another carjacking on Sunday. The suspects in one event were described as wearing dark clothing with T-shirts over their faces and using handguns. Most importantly, several were described as possibly being teenagers.
